Choosing Your Skills: A Guide to End Mill Selection
When it comes to machining, selecting the appropriate end mill is essential. A poorly selected end mill can result in unsatisfactory results, ruining your workpiece and wasting valuable time.
Here's a summary to help you navigate the right end mill for your next project:
* **Material:** The material you're cutting is the primary consideration. Different materials demand different types of end mills. For example, iron requires a stronger end mill than softwoods.
* **Cutting Action:** Evaluate the type of cutting action you need.
* Heavy-duty end mills are designed for removing large amounts of material quickly.
* Precision end mills are used for creating smooth, accurate surfaces.
* **Diameter and Flute Count:** The diameter of the end mill affects the size of the cut you can make. The number of flutes affects chip evacuation and surface finish.
* **Shank Size:** The shank size must be compatible with your machine's collet or chuck.
By carefully considering these factors, you can select the optimal end mill for your needs, resulting in accurate parts and a smoother machining process.

Identifying the Perfect End Mill Tool for Every Job
End mills are essential cutting tools utilized in a variety of machining operations. From precision drilling to intricate shaping, these versatile tools can manage a wide range of tasks. To ensure optimal performance, it's crucial to select the appropriate end mill type for each specific job.
A fundamental consideration is the material being machined. Different materials require distinct end mill geometries and coatings. For instance, high-speed steel website (HSS) end mills are well-suited for ferrous alloys, while carbide end mills excel in cutting hardened steels.
Additionally, the type of operation influences end mill selection. For roughing applications, which involve removing large amounts of material, large end mills with multiple flutes are preferred. In contrast, finishing operations demand smaller, sharper end mills for achieving precise surface finishes.
Ultimately, understanding the various end mill types and their respective applications is key to achieving successful machining results.
